EarthSense 2024” (#66084) – IEEE INTERNATIONAL CONFERENCE ON NEXT-GEN TECHNOLOGIES OF ARTIFICIAL INTELLIGENCE AND GEOSCIENCE REMOTE SENSING is a global conference that brings together scientists, engineers, industry leaders, and policymakers to explore the latest innovations in artificial intelligence and geoscience remote sensing technologies. It is in collaboration with KL University and IEEE SB KLEF. It is technically sponsored by IEEE GRSS (GeoScience and Remote Sensing Society). The conference will focus on the next-generation tools, methodologies, and applications driving advancements in Earth observation, environmental monitoring, and resource management. The conference is a unique platform for showcasing cutting-edge research, fostering interdisciplinary collaborations, and discussing future directions in geospatial and remote sensing science. It aims to advance these fields and promote sustainable and ethical AI/ML practices in the geoscience domain by bringing together researchers, practitioners, and policymakers.
